Diego Wayar is a 32-year-old football player who plays as a midfielder for Real Tomayapo, born on October 15, 1993, who is right-footed. Follow Diego Wayar on FotMob for live match updates, detailed statistics, career history, transfer news, FotMob ratings, and comprehensive performance analytics.

In the 2025 Primera División season, Diego Wayar has recorded 0 goals, 0 assists, 148 minutes, an average FotMob rating of 6.44, 2 yellow cards.

Diego Wayar's career has also included time at The Strongest.

On the international stage, Diego Wayar has represented Bolivia.

Throughout their career, Diego Wayar has won 4 titles: Primera División (2016/2017 Apertura, 2013/2014 Apertura, 2012/2013 Apertura, 2011/2012 Clausura) with The Strongest.

Diego Wayar has competed in Primera División, Copa Libertadores, Copa Libertadores Qualification qualification, Copa Sudamericana, Copa America, and World Cup CONMEBOL qualification.
